Roadways and Sidewalks

The Township maintains over 384 kilometers of roads. Over half of the roads are asphalt or surface treated while 47% of the roads are gravel based. The Township has a full complement of staff and equipment to maintain and repair the roads year around. Most construction and reconstruction is contracted out to private firms.

In 2003, the Township completed a roads management study that identified the state of each road and recommended a five-year capital works and roads management plan, including estimated costs and funding levels. Council and staff use this plan as a basis for each year's planning and budgeting.

In the villages of Morrisburg, Iroquois and Williamsburg, the Township maintains sidewalks along some of its roads and streets. The sidewalks are generally along busier roadways in order to ensure pedestrian safety.

The Township uses the provincial Minimum Standard Roads Policy as legislated by Ontario Regulation 239/02. The regulation addresses routine patrolling, snow accumulation, ice on roadways, potholes, should drop-offs, cracks, debris, lighting, signs, traffic control, and bridge and deck spall/discontinuity for municipal roadways. The purpose of minimum maintenance standards is to reduce liabilities, provide a consistent level of service and reduce long-term costs by maintaining this essential infrastructure.

Permits

The Township issues permits for the use of its road allowances. It issues the following permits:

Permit Type Purpose
entrance for an entrance off a Township road or street
ditch fill-in to fill in a ditch in front of a property along a Township road or street
tile drain to use the road allowance for a tile drain or to empty a tile drain into a ditch in the Township road allowance
utility to bury utilities in the Township road allowance

Applications for permits are available at the Municipal Office in Williamsburg. There is a processing fee for each permit. The Township will determine whether the request will be permitted and the standards, material and any equipment required. All costs relating to the work are the responsibility of the applicant.
